T
he King’s School annual cross country held last termwas as big as ever with a great
turnout of boys and spectators. It was a muddy track with a heavy downpour at one
point during the day, but all the same everyone gave it their all. This year the event
was held at Shore Road which, unlike most cross countries, was flat with no hills. But there
were plenty of muddy spots and waterlogged parts to negotiate! Afterwards, there was a
race to the changing rooms with boys and their muddy gear spilling out of the doorway.
Bruce House took out the overall House win of the day. The top 10 winners of the senior
competition went on to the Cross Country Eastern Zones, and King’s School came 2nd overall
which was a fantastic effort! George Cory-Wright and Joseph Nevill Jackson came 1st and 2nd
respectively in the individual standings. George then went on to win a 2nd place in the Auckland
Zone competition.
